Araluen Botanic Park
Araluen Botanic Park is located in a sheltered valley in the Darling Ranges, approximately 30 kilometres south of Perth, Western Australia, in the suburb of Roleystone.Photo: Petedavo, Public domain.

Churchman Brook Dam
Dam
Photo: SeanMack,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Churchman Brook Dam is an earth-fill embankment dam approximately 30 kilometres southeast of Perth, Western Australia in the City of Armadale. The reservoir serves as a source of potable water for Perth. Churchman Brook Dam is situated 4 km southwest of Araluen Botanic Park.

Karragullen
Suburb
Photo: Gnangarra, CC BY 2.5 au.
Karragullen is a suburb of Perth, Western Australia, located within the City of Armadale. Its postcode is 6111. Prior to 1949, it was a stopping place on the Upper Darling Range railway. Karragullen is situated 4 km northeast of Araluen Botanic Park.
Canning Mills
Suburb
Canning Mills is a suburb of Perth, Western Australia in the City of Kalamunda. The suburb was gazetted on 22 September 1972. Its name relates to the Canning River. Canning Mills is situated 6 km north of Araluen Botanic Park.
